Are your new starters asking for specific client information?
For any number of reasons, staff turnover happens. And it calls for excellent customer service.
If you don’t have a CRM, vital client information will eventually fall through the cracks. The time and effort you’ve put into getting to know your clients will be chiselled away. And they’ll be left feeling like less than a priority.
Are your employees tied to a specific location, desk or workspace?
Instant access to vital information is crucial for any business and its employees. Storing your data on a cloud CRM system is the only way to consistently have access to that, laying the foundations for more successful sales processes and a more memorable customer experience.
Is your workforce divided or working remotely?
Every department has a role to play in creating an irresistible customer experience. Marketing captures leads, Sales close deals, Customer Service nurtures relationships, and so on.
Without clear communication and on-demand access to information between these teams, your clients will be repeating the same information to different individuals, leading to a poor experience.
Is your Sales team too dependent on their ‘gut feeling’?
Smart personalisation and nurturing leads make a world of difference to your sales results. But what if your Sales team has no way of seeing which leads are ripe and ready – and which ones need more time?
In short, you’ll be losing money. And an effective CRM can stop that.
Is your reporting process time-consuming?
When it comes to reporting, if your crucial data is split across numerous sources, difficult to access or impossible to translate, you need a CRM.
Streamlined reporting is the backbone of business success, giving you a clear picture of how well you’re doing, and the next logical step.
